Amynothrips andersoni (alligator weed thrips)

Wikipedia Abstract

Amynothrips andersoni is a species of thrips known as alligator weed thrips. It has been used as an agent of biological pest control against the noxious aquatic plant known as alligator weed (Alternanthera philoxeroides).
